CI troubleshooting: the Pellarin query planner regression surfaced in the nightly perf suite — join ordering on three-table queries reverted to nested loops, tripling latency on the benchmark set. Bisection points to the cost-model refactor merged Tuesday. Mira has a revert prepared; please hold the release train until the perf suite is green. The implicated build token follows.

build token for kagaf-hahof: htk14_9d3d4d26d7d8de

The legacy ORM layer was replaced with the new query builder. Defaults changed: lazy loading is now off, connection pooling is on by default, and implicit transactions around single writes were removed — wrap multi-statement writes explicitly. N+1 queries that previously went unnoticed will now raise warnings in dev. Migration shims for the old API remain until v5 but log deprecation notices. New team members should read the query-builder guide before touching persistence code. The new defaults are as follows.

settings of fafog-haduf:
ZORIX_PIN=4648
ZORIX_METRICS_HOST=metrics.zorix.paliqsys.corp
ZORIX_LOG_LEVEL=info
ZORIX_TENANT=druix

To all sales leads at Merrowvale Goods: the Lanthorn Rewards scheme will be restructured over the next two quarters. Points accrual moves from spend-based to margin-based, and the Silverbeck tier is retired. Please review current accounts carefully, as roughly a third of enrolled customers — particularly those onboarded through the Castevane channel — will see changed entitlements. Briefing packs follow next week from Odile Frant. The confidential commercial plan underpinning these changes appears directly below.

internal memo for hafog-hadug: The pricing group signed off on a budget of $16.1 million for Project Gorir. The renewal with Oliionax Systems closes at $14.1 million a year, 46 percent above the last contract.

Welcome to Nightjar, our scheduler for nightly data backfills. It kicks off jobs after the warehouse snapshot lands, usually around 02:00. Most of what you'll touch lives in the `backfill-specs` repo — each job is a YAML file, nothing fancy. If a backfill stalls, check the snapshot marker before blaming the scheduler. Stuck beyond that? Ping the Nightjar maintainers directly.

escalation mailbox, kafof-kawif: oliix@qirvanworks.corp